Dennis M. Schmauch, age 81, passed away on May 11 after a long fight with congestive heart failure and COPD. Dennis was born in Dillon, Montana, on July 25, 1942 and moved to Spokane after he served two years active duty in the army. He joined the army reserve while working on a degree in...

I should have added in my previous post that Dennis was one of a very few individuals in the country to be Double Distinguished - Distinguished Pistol & Distinguished Rifle shooter. It took a lot of determination, training and competition to achieve that. He was also a good friend!

Very sorry to hear of Dennis passing. I was in the WA Army National Guard and Dennis & I shot together for years in competition. We made a couple of trips to Las Vegas in the 1980's to shoot in matches. I have fond memories of the times we had together!

Condolences, I replaced Dennis as the pistol team captain, we kept the program going many years but it was never as competitive as when Dennis ran it.
